Ash (White)

April 14, 2017

Scientific Name: Fraxinus Americana
Common Names: White Ash, Green Ash, Brown Ash, Tough Ash, Swamp Ash
Market Availability: Usually plentiful in 4/4 – 8/4 thickness
Common Uses: Flooring, furniture, cabinets, handles, baseball bats, mouldings
Regional Differences: Ash from northern regions will have a higher heartwood content than Appalachian or Southern Ash. Swamp Ash from far Southern states may be too soft in texture for furniture or flooring. However, Swamp Ash weighing less than 2.8 lbs per board foot is in high demand for guitar stock.
Color Specifications: Sap 1 Face & Better, Unselected, Brown
Grade: NHLA Standard Grade Rules
Defects to consider: Glass worm, sticker shadow, stain
Alternatives: Oak, maple, hickory
Shipping Weight: Kiln dried: 3700 lbs/MBF (711 kg/m3) net tally
Specific Gravity: Kiln Dried 0.62, Green 0.52
Compressive Strength: (Perpendicular to grain) 1160 psi
Janka Hardness: (Pounds-force) 1320
